Do you respect it? It has 229 hectares. Show me the 229 hectares, show me my land according to the offer letter. How is that difficult? I will stay wherever I want to stay in my piece of land,\u201d said Mbudzana in a dialogue that was recorded on video, with Le Vieux who kept asking questions.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"3bf5bfc6-bd97-7266-0a2a-cc176dbd6d16\" class=\"article-widget article-widget-text\">\n<div class=\"wrap\">\n<div class=\"text\">\n<p>The 229 hectares that Mbudzana wants has an almost ripe crop on it. If he takes over the land he is expected to simply harvest. His \u201coffer letter\u201d to take over the farm was issued on January 10. FarFell Coffee Estate is contesting the matter in the high court.<\/p>\n<p>Le Vieux said he challenged the legality of the notice but declined to comment about the matter as it is sub judice.\u00a0\u201cMy lawyers are handling the matter so there is nothing to talk about. All I want is for my world-renowned coffee brand to be saved,\u201d he said.<\/p>\n<p>The \u201ceviction team\u201d went to the farm last Sunday accompanied by a police chief from Chipinge: inspector Dohwa. The policeman said the farmer\u2019s refusal to let them onto the land as it was a resting day was disrespectful.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I actually thought you would respect us as police officers, and when we come, we normally don\u2019t just come to have fun,\u201d said Dohwa.<\/p>\n<p>Lands, Agriculture, Water, Climate and Rural Settlements minister Perence Shiri said in 2018 that farm invasions were a thing of the past and \u201clawlessness and anarchy\u201d would not be allowed to prevail.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"5dffafb0-de97-2949-41d3-5b5827fd1dac\" class=\"article-widget article-widget-text\">\n<div class=\"wrap\">\n<div class=\"text\">\n<p>At the time government had resolved to compensate farmers that were displaced during a land reform program that saw at least 4,000 white commercial farmers displaced. Some ended up in countries such as Zambia and Nigeria, strengthening the backbone of those countries\u2019 agrarian sectors.<\/p>\n<p>At the height of the farm invasions, government took some farms that were initially protected by Bilateral Investment Promotion and Protection Agreements (Bippas) between governments. Government records show that 197 out of 258 farms, measuring 977,000 hectares, under Bippa were acquired for resettlement.<\/p>\n<p>Countries such as South Africa, Denmark, Germany, Belgium, the Netherlands, Italy, Malaysia and Switzerland have land under Bippas.<\/p>\n<p>Farm evictions dented Harare\u2019s international image for investors. Finance minister professor Mthuli Ncube said recently that government was finalising compensation packages for white former land owners.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e have made progress in compensating the white farmers and the farmers themselves have also managed to come up with a figure on what they want to be compensated.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cOn our side as government, we have done our evaluations using the white farmers\u2019 methodology for nine provinces on the value of improvements,\u201d he said.<\/p>\n<p>Government requires at least US $9bn for the process but put a mere US $53m aside in the 2019 budget.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"wp-post-navigation\"><\/div>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Remembrance Gwaradzimba, the son of a Zanu-PF official, arrived to evict the owner of a farm in Zimbabwe renowned for its coffee.\u00a0 Image:\u00a0nito500\/123rf A video clip of a senior Zanu-PF official\u2019s son arriving to evict the owner of a well-known farm has sent jitters through Zimbabwe.
